What £55 a person actually gets you
The same four things every small office needs. Backups and antimalware are the foundation. The first one is the part people tell us they value most.
Somebody answers
Ring in the day and a person picks up. Email, portal or message and you’ll have a written reply within two working hours. Most fixes happen on your screen, remotely, in minutes.
Backups that are proven
Your files and your email backed up daily, and we test them by restoring something, so you know they work. If a laptop dies or somebody deletes the wrong folder, it comes back.
Clean, updated, watched
Antimalware on every machine, updates done at a quiet time rather than the middle of your day, and monitoring that spots a failing disk early, while there’s still time to do something about it.
Microsoft 365 looked after
Accounts, licences, sign-in security and the settings that are easy to get wrong when it’s not your day job. New starter on Monday, leaver on Friday, both handled for you.

IT support in Chester: the questions people ask first
Are you actually in Chester?
Eric's on the Wirral, and Chester is covered the same way. Support is remote first because that's what fixes things fastest: you ring, a person picks up, and they're on your screen in minutes. On-site visits are by arrangement, for the things that need a pair of hands, and they're the exception rather than the routine. There's no ongoing on-site response promise, so you know where you stand from the start.
How much is IT support in Chester?
£55 a person a month, and that person's machines are all in it, however many they use. Two people is £110, ten is £550. Registered charities are £35 a machine with no minimum. Servers, Azure and network kit are priced per box, on top, only if they need looking after, and you'd know the whole number before agreeing to anything.
We've already got an IT company. Why would we move?
If you're happy with them, stay with them. The reasons people usually give for moving are not being able to reach a person, callbacks that don't happen, and invoices that keep growing. If that sounds familiar, we'll do the switch for you: nothing for your team to prepare, no downtime day, and we're set up inside seven days or that month is on us. Check when your current agreement ends first; that date decides the timing.
Will you come out to us?
Yes, when a visit is the right fix, by arrangement. Most problems are sorted remotely in minutes, which saves you waiting in. New machines, cabling, a Wi-Fi survey in a workshop: those are visits, and we'd book them.
We're on Chester Business Park with our own server. Is that covered?
The people are £55 each. A server is priced on its own, per box, once we've seen what it does, and you'd know the whole number before agreeing to anything. A lot of servers on the Park are doing a job Microsoft 365 already does; if that's yours, we'll say so, because retiring it is cheaper than paying us to look after it.
